// S_code DA supplement - AJAX and other functions
function ajaxCartViewTracking(acct,obj) {
  s=s_gi(acct);
  s.trackingServer="metrics.seenon.com"
  s.trackingServerSecure="smetrics.seenon.com";
  s.linkTrackVars='events';
  s.linkTrackEvents='scView';
  s.events='scView';
  s.tl(obj,'o','AJAX Cart');
  s.linkTrackVars='None';
  s.linkTrackEvents='None';
  s.events='';
}

function ajaxCartAddTracking(acct,obj,prod) {
  s=s_gi(acct);
  s.trackingServer="metrics.seenon.com"
  s.trackingServerSecure="smetrics.seenon.com";
  s.linkTrackVars='events,products';
  s.linkTrackEvents='scAdd';
  s.products=';'+prod;
  s.events='scAdd';
  s.tl(obj,'o','AJAX Cart Add');
  s.linkTrackVars='None';
  s.linkTrackEvents='None';
  s.events='';
  s.products='';
}

function ajaxQuickViewTracking(acct,obj,prod) {
  s=s_gi(acct);
  s.trackingServer="metrics.seenon.com"
  s.trackingServerSecure="smetrics.seenon.com";
  s.linkTrackVars='events,products';
  s.linkTrackEvents='prodView,event3';
  s.products=';'+prod;
  s.events='prodView,event3';
  s.tl(obj,'o','AJAX Quick View');
  s.linkTrackVars='None';
  s.linkTrackEvents='None';
  s.events='';
  s.products='';
}

function ajaxCheckoutStep2(acct,obj) {
  s=s_gi(acct);
  s.trackingServer="metrics.seenon.com"
  s.trackingServerSecure="smetrics.seenon.com";
  s.linkTrackVars='events';
  s.linkTrackEvents='event4';
  s.events='event4';
  s.tl(obj,'o','AJAX Checkout - Step 2: Shipping');
  s.linkTrackVars='None';
  s.linkTrackEvents='None';
}

function ajaxCheckoutStep3(acct,obj) {
  s=s_gi(acct);
  s.trackingServer="metrics.seenon.com"
  s.trackingServerSecure="smetrics.seenon.com";
  s.linkTrackVars='events';
  s.linkTrackEvents='event5';
  s.events='event5';
  s.tl(obj,'o','AJAX Checkout - Step 3: Payment');
  s.linkTrackVars='None';
  s.linkTrackEvents='None';
}

function ajaxCheckoutStep4(acct,obj) {
  s=s_gi(acct);
  s.trackingServer="metrics.seenon.com"
  s.trackingServerSecure="smetrics.seenon.com";
  s.linkTrackVars='events';
  s.linkTrackEvents='event6';
  s.events='event6';
  s.tl(obj,'o','AJAX Checkout - Step 4: Review');
  s.linkTrackVars='None';
  s.linkTrackEvents='None';
}

function ajaxCheckoutPurchase(acct,obj,state,zip,products,purchaseID,eVar5,eVar6,eVar7,eVar8) {
  s=s_gi(acct);
  s.trackingServer="metrics.seenon.com"
  s.trackingServerSecure="smetrics.seenon.com";
  s.linkTrackVars='events,state,zip,products,purchaseID,eVar5,eVar6,eVar7,eVar8';
  s.linkTrackEvents='purchase';
  s.events='purchase';
  s.state=state;
  s.zip=zip;
  s.products=products;
  s.purchaseID=purchaseID;
  s.eVar5=eVar5;
  s.eVar6=eVar6;
  s.eVar7=eVar7;
  s.eVar8=eVar8;
  s.tl(obj,'o','AJAX Checkout - Order Confirmation');
  s.linkTrackVars='None';
  s.linkTrackEvents='None';
}

